The Maintenance Mechanic position performs preventive and corrective maintenance in the plant under management supervision at our Ward Facility. Essential Duties/Responsibilities Nothing in this job description restricts management's right to assign or reassign duties and responsibilities to this job at any time. Performs all phases of maintenance, including electrical and mechanical systems (i.e. fabricating, welding troubleshooting, repairing, installing, and performing required preventative maintenance). Maintains all equipment in good working condition. Follows preventative maintenance schedule. Able to perform routine services and troubleshoot and repair all rendering equipment. Maintains clean, neat, and orderly work area at all times. Assists personnel on special fabrication and construction projects. Performs machine repair and installation such as replacing motors, rebuilding gear boxes, run threaded piping, run weld piping, replace belting, replace bearings, welds and uses cutting torch. Conducts daily greasing and oiling of plant equipment as needed. Diagnoses and replaces equipment parts with little or no direction. Communicates well with operators and management. Responsible for using assigned personal protective equipment and required safety equipment; responsible for being familiar with and observing all Company safety rules and regulations. Attends regularly scheduled safety meetings and may be asked to serve on Safety Committee. All other duties as assigned.
